Sustainability is no longer just a trend; it is now a necessity in the lingerie industry. Manufacturers and exporters must prioritize eco-friendly practices to meet consumer demands and comply with regulations.
Today's consumers prefer brands that demonstrate a commitment to environmental responsibility. This shift is especially prominent among younger demographics who prioritize sustainable practices in their purchasing decisions.
Using sustainable materials such as organic cotton and recycled fabrics not only reduces environmental impact but also appeals to conscious consumers. This approach can enhance a brand's reputation and sales.
Many countries have implemented stringent regulations concerning textile production and export. Adhering to these standards not only ensures legal compliance but also improves a company's credibility.
Obtaining certifications for sustainable practices can set a brand apart in a crowded market. It reassures consumers about the quality and environmental impact of the products they purchase.
Highlighting sustainability in marketing campaigns can attract a broader audience. Sharing stories about eco-friendly materials and ethical production processes can enhance customer engagement.
Social media platforms provide an excellent opportunity to showcase sustainable practices. Engaging content can educate consumers about the importance of choosing eco-friendly lingerie.
Embracing sustainability is crucial for lingerie manufacturers and exporters looking to thrive in the global marketplace. By committing to eco-friendly practices and effectively marketing them, brands can appeal to a growing base of conscious consumers.
